Job Description Summary
The Senior Specialist - Compliance & Regulatory will be a core member of the GE Aerospace Ombuds team that leads development and implementing an overall strategy for the Open Reporting program at GE Aerospace. The Senior Specialist - Compliance & Regulatory will be a lawyer or Compliance professional, responsible for ensuring prompt logging and assignment of investigations, assisting with open investigations including projects to reduce case aging and reporting themes, mentoring a network of >80 part-time site Ombuds, and preventing overdue corrective actions for a variety of matters involving alleged violations of: law, GE Aerospace policy, non-policy matters, and/or assistance answering compliance questions.

This Senior Specialist - Compliance & Regulatory must have a proven record of being thorough, fair, and objective with attention to detail, and timely and adapt easily to working in a diverse and multicultural work environment.

Job Description

Roles and Responsibilities
  • Lead and handle independent case logging and issuance.
  • Conduct concern raiser intakes as needed.
  • Ability to identify and understand trends; analyze and report out on such trends and thereby enable the organization to respond in a timely and proactive manner.
  • Lead projects related to reducing case aging, gaining ombuds efficiencies/lean, and preventing corrective actions from becoming overdue.
  • Partner and mentor network of >80 part-time site Ombuds.
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ree from an accredited university.
  • A minimum of 8 years of professional experience in Ombuds, workplace investigations, compliance, law, internal audit, controllership, or related field.
  • Professional fluency in English is required.
Desired Characteristics
  • Outstanding commun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to work effectively with people at various levels of the organization.
  • Excellent facilitation and presentation skills, proven ability to clearly and concisely prepare, present, and discuss findings and recommendations at a senior level and produce clear and compelling report.
  • Proven analytical and evaluation skills.
  • Demonstrated problem-solving skills.
  • Proven ability to digest large amounts of information and distill it into the essential elements.
  • Highest personal integrity with demonstrate ability to handle confidential matters in a discreet and respectful manner.
  • Ability to maintain confidentiality and inspire trust.
  • Experience performing difficult conversations.
  • Self-motivated with ability to handle a large and varied caseload simultaneously, to multitask, and to work independently with minimal supervision.
  • Ability to interface effectively with senior business and functional leaders throughout the organization.
  • Process and detail-oriented, including strong organizational skills and ability to prioritize.
  • High level of cultural sensitivity, flexibility and emotional intelligence in order to work effectively within GE Aerospace's multicultural environment.
  • Strong oral and written communication skills.
  • Strong skillset in Power Point and Excel.
